Developing Athletic Abilities in Children

The Importance of Physical Activity for Children

Physical activity is crucial for the development of children, playing a significant role in their overall health and well-being. Engaging in sports and other physical activities helps children build strong bones and muscles, control their weight, and reduce the risk of developing chronic diseases such as diabetes and obesity.

Benefits of Developing Athletic Abilities at a Young Age

Developing athletic abilities in children from a young age not only contributes to their physical health but also fosters important life skills. Participation in sports and physical activities teaches children the value of teamwork, discipline, and perseverance. It also enhances their self-esteem and confidence, setting the stage for future success in various aspects of their lives.

Choosing the Right Sports for Children

When it comes to developing athletic abilities in children, it is essential to choose the right sports that align with their interests and physical capabilities. Some children may excel in individual sports like tennis or swimming, while others may thrive in team sports such as soccer or basketball. It is important to encourage children to explore different sports to find the ones that resonate with them the most.

The Role of Parents and Coaches

Parents and coaches play a vital role in nurturing and developing the athletic abilities of children. It is important for parents to support and encourage their children to participate in physical activities, providing them with the necessary resources and guidance. Coaches also play a crucial role in fostering a positive and supportive environment for children to develop their athletic skills, emphasizing the importance of effort and sportsmanship over winning at all costs.

Creating a Balanced Approach

While developing athletic abilities is important, it is equally crucial to maintain a balanced approach. Children should be encouraged to participate in sports and physical activities for enjoyment, rather than solely focusing on competition and performance. It is essential to create a positive and supportive environment where children can explore and develop their athletic abilities without feeling pressured or overwhelmed.
